Poetry Jam with One Poem a Day Won’t Kill You

April 16, 2024 @ 6:00 pm - 7:00 pm

What’s better than reading poetry? Sharing your favorite poems with friends and neighbors! What’s better than sharing your favorite poems with friends and neighbors? Sharing your favorite poems with friends and neighbors while eating snacks at the Library!

This year, One Poem a Day Won’t Kill You (the Library’s daily National Poetry Month celebration) invites you to bring one or more of your favorite poems to read, discuss, and share with other poetry lovers (poems should be previously published and not your own work). Attendees will have the option to record themselves reading their poems for release on a special podcast episode at the end of National Poetry Month.

Don’t know what to read? Stop by the Circulation Desk and pick up a different “pocket poem” each day in April!
